The Director of the para operations of the Indian Air Force has been arrested for espionage by a special cell of the Delhi police.
Arun Marwa, who was the group captain of the Indian Air force and posted in New Delhi had been detained earlier by counter intelligence wing of IAF and questioned for possible spying for Pakistan.
The Delhi police special cell after filing the case, arrested the 51-year-old officer, who was later produced at the Patiala House Court and sent to police remand for five days. They have also confiscated the officer’s phone.
The special cell is investigating the matter further and trying to gather all the information that has been shared by the officer with ISI .
